Read What Might Be Drake Jones’s Last Interview Ever

Drake Jones remains one of the most influential skaters of all time. While he’s likely barely on the radar of the current generation, a little bit of Drake’s style is still present in modern skating. SML recently gave the former Real and FTC pro a signature guest wheel. And Evan Schiefelbine sat down for an extensive interview with him in honor of the occasion, which, according to Drake,  will likely be his last. That’s too bad. His name has definitely come up when discussing potential guests for Mission Statement.
